Output 72f63bd7354b90ded8e3e507cca5d83741a83367798cdfb11dfbd9e1ec0bd3b9:62

value
511654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90e4a639820658df6c0c56e6d4d42f7a2a5cc79 OP_EQUAL
address
3H6uEtaj43QzruiuaJsrXVn4bqpos7vTpR
transaction
72f63bd7354b90ded8e3e507cca5d83741a83367798cdfb11dfbd9e1ec0bd3b9
spent
true